]> WPIA git - gigi.git/blob - src/club/wpia/gigi/dbObjects/DomainPingExecution.java
fix: ResultSet.getDate is often wrong as it fetches day-precision times
[gigi.git] / src / club / wpia / gigi / dbObjects / DomainPingExecution.java
1 package club.wpia.gigi.dbObjects;
2
3 import java.sql.Timestamp;
4 import java.util.Date;
5
6 import club.wpia.gigi.database.GigiResultSet;
7
8 public class DomainPingExecution {
9
10     private String state;
11
12     private String type;
13
14     private String info;
15
16     private String result;
17
18     private DomainPingConfiguration config;
19
20     private Timestamp date;
21
22     public DomainPingExecution(GigiResultSet rs) {
23         state = rs.getString(1);
24         type = rs.getString(2);
25         info = rs.getString(3);
26         result = rs.getString(4);
27         config = DomainPingConfiguration.getById(rs.getInt(5));
28         date = rs.getTimestamp(6);
29     }
30
31     public String getState() {
32         return state;
33     }
34
35     public String getType() {
36         return type;
37     }
38
39     public String getInfo() {
40         return info;
41     }
42
43     public String getResult() {
44         return result;
45     }
46
47     public DomainPingConfiguration getConfig() {
48         return config;
49     }
50
51     public Date getDate() {
52         return date;
53     }
54
55 }